Senior Real Estate Agent Salary in Torrington, CT: $87,224 (2026)
Quick Answer:The top tier of real estate agents working in Torrington, CT — those at or above the 90th percentile — pull in $87,224/year or more for 2026, based on BLS OEWS 2025 estimates for SOC 41-9022. Strip back Torrington's price premium (BEA RPP 107.9, 8% above national) and that top-decile pay carries the same buying power as $80,838 in average-cost America. The 55% spread above city median typically rewards 7+ years of practice or specialty credentials.

Maximizing Your Real Estate Agent Earnings in Torrington
Senior real estate agents in Torrington often command higher salaries due to their specialization in lucrative markets, such as luxury or high-end residential properties, and commercial real estate sectors, including office and retail spaces. Working under recognized national brokerages like Keller Williams or Coldwell Banker can greatly influence compensation structure, with larger firms typically offering more robust resources and networks. However, independent firms and niche luxury agencies may present unique opportunities for top performers. To enhance earning potential, experienced agents often pursue advanced credentials beyond the state real estate sales license, like the NAR Realtor designation or commercial certifications such as CCIM. Compensation isn’t solely about salary; factors like transaction volume, commission splits, and referral networks significantly impact overall income. With the evolving structure of commissions post-2024, strategic positioning as a team-based agent or a broker-in-charge can also alter the trajectory of career earnings in this dynamic CT market.
